Gunilla Palmstierna-Weiss
Gunilla Palmstierna-Weiss (1928–2022) was a Swedish writer, ceramicist and sculptor.

Overview
Born at Lausanne in 1928, died at Stockholm in 2022.
In detail
Gunilla Palmstierna-Weiss studied at Konstfack. the recorded working language is German.
The field of work recorded is scenography and costume design.
Places of work recorded in the authority are Stockholm.
Work by Gunilla Palmstierna-Weiss is recorded in the collections of Nationalmuseum.
Distinctions recorded are Cross of the Order of Merit of the Federal Republic of Germany, Tony Award for Best Costume Design and Professor.
